Steven Robert Karmelin of West Palm Beach, Florida, a stockbroker currently registered with RBC Capital Markets, LLC, is the subject of a customer initiated investment related written complaint brought by a customer on August 14, 2017, where the customer sought $280,000.00 in damages founded on accusations that between February 4, 2011 and August 7, 2017, Karmelin made unsuitable municipal debt recommendations.

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A) Public Disclosure additionally reveals that on April 25, 2011, a customer filed an investment related written complaint regarding Karmelin’s activities, in which the customer requested $54,352.00 in damages supported by allegations that Karmelin effected unsuitable closed end fund transactions in the customer’s trust account.

Furthermore, on November 10, 2014, a customer filed an investment related written complaint involving Karmelin’s conduct, where the customer alleged that she was mistreated, misinformed and misled regarding exchange traded funds effected in her account. The customer also alleged that a third-party money manager churned her investment portfolio.
